Stem cells are broadly categorized into embryonic, Grownup, and induced pluripotent stem cells (iPSCs). Embryonic stem cells, derived from early-stage embryos, are extremely versatile but elevate moral factors. Grownup stem cells, present in tissues like bone marrow or Excess fat, are significantly less controversial but have much more confined differentiation probable. iPSCs, developed by reprogramming adult cells to an embryonic-like condition, provide a promising Center ground, combining flexibility with less ethical problems. The probable of stem cells lies within their power to fix or replace destroyed tissues. As an example, in neurodegenerative health conditions like Parkinson’s, stem cells may be used to make dopamine-producing neurons, perhaps restoring function. In cardiology, stem cell therapies are increasingly being explored to regenerate heart tissue put up-myocardial infarction. In the same way, in orthopedics, stem cells present assure in repairing cartilage or bone in problems like osteoarthritis.
